杜仲提取物对运动后小鼠血清尿素氮、肝糖原和血乳酸含量的影响

The Effects of Eucommia ulmoids Oliv. Extract on The Mice’s concentrations of Serum Urea Nitrogen, Hepatic Glycogen, andBlood Lactate

【摘要】 目的:研究杜仲醇提水溶部位(DT)对小鼠运动及运动后代谢变化的影响。方法:对小鼠负重游泳时间、运动后血清尿素氮、肝糖原、血乳酸含量进行测定。结果:杜仲醇提水溶部位不影响小鼠正常体重。延长负重游泳时间、降低运动后血清尿素氮含量,增加肝糖原含量,降低血乳酸含量。结论:杜仲醇提水溶部位具有抗疲劳作用。

【Abstract】 AIM: We examined the effect of taking extracts from Eucommia ulmoides Oliv. bark, on experimental mice’s motor ability and some biochemical criterions. The extract was the concentrated aqueous layer of the total MeOH extract of the bark that was extracted by petroleum ether and CHCl3 from separately. METHOD: The experimental mice were taken Eucommia ulmoides Oliv. extract for thirty days, with three different dosages. The body weight changes were observed every 15 days. On the thirtieth day of the experimental period, the load swimming exercise was conducted and the swimming time was recorded. Then the concentrations of serum urea nitrogen, hepatic glycogen, and blood lactate were determined. RESULT: After the mice taking the extract of Eucommia ulmoides Oliv. bark, while the experimental mice body weights are normal, the load swimming time is prolonged, and the extract can lower the concentration of serum urea nitrogen and blood lactate, elevate the hepatic glycogen concentration, significantly, compared with the control group respectively. CONCLUSION: These results suggest that Eucommia ulmoides Oliv. bark extract help the body resist fatigue.
